Sumber Jadwal Sholat Palembang Terpercaya

Okay, so where can we find these super important prayer times? There are several reliable sources out there, both online and offline. Let's break them down:

Online Platforms

  1. Websites Khusus Jadwal Sholat: There are tons of websites dedicated to providing accurate prayer times for cities around the world. Websites like IslamicFinder, Muslim Pro, and WaktuSolat.net are solid options. They usually have user-friendly interfaces, and you can easily search for Palembang to get the times. The best part? Many of them also offer prayer time notifications, so you won’t miss a thing!
  2. Aplikasi Mobile: Mobile apps are lifesavers, aren't they? Apps like Muslim Pro, Athan Pro, and My Prayer are designed to give you the jadwal sholat right on your phone. These apps often come with extra features too, like Qibla direction finders, Quran recitations, and reminders. They're super handy for staying on top of your prayers, no matter where you are. Plus, you can set alarms, so it's like having a personal prayer time assistant!
  3. Situs Resmi Kementerian Agama: For the most official and reliable source, check out the website of the Indonesian Ministry of Religious Affairs (Kementerian Agama). They regularly update prayer times based on precise calculations. This is a great way to ensure you’re getting the most accurate information. It's like going straight to the source – no guesswork involved.

Offline Sources

  1. Masjid Lokal: Your local mosque is a fantastic resource. Mosques often post the daily prayer times, and they're usually very accurate. Plus, you get to connect with your community! It’s a great way to stay informed and feel connected to your local Muslim community. Plus, you can ask the imam any questions you have about prayer times or practices.
  2. Kalender Islam: Islamic calendars usually include the jadwal sholat for major cities. These calendars are readily available in many bookstores and Islamic centers. They’re a convenient way to have the prayer times on hand, especially if you prefer a physical reminder. You can hang it in your home or office and easily glance at it throughout the day.

Cara Membaca Jadwal Sholat

Okay, now that we know where to find the jadwal sholat, let's make sure we know how to read it! It might seem straightforward, but let's break it down to avoid any confusion. Knowing how to correctly interpret these schedules is crucial for ensuring we pray at the right times. So, let's get into the details, guys!

Firstly, the jadwal sholat Palembang typically lists the times for the five daily prayers: Fajr, Dhuhr, Asr, Maghrib, and Isha. Each prayer has a specific time frame within which it must be performed. Fajr, the dawn prayer, is performed before sunrise; Dhuhr is the midday prayer; Asr is the afternoon prayer; Maghrib is the sunset prayer; and Isha is the night prayer. These times are calculated based on the position of the sun, which means they vary slightly each day.

The times are usually presented in a 24-hour format (e.g., 05:00 for 5:00 AM, 17:00 for 5:00 PM), which helps avoid any confusion between AM and PM. When you look at the schedule, you'll see five different times listed, each corresponding to one of the prayers. The times indicate the beginning of the prayer time. This means you can pray anytime after that listed time until the start of the next prayer time, except for Fajr and Asr, which have specific end times as well.

It’s also important to understand the terms used. Imsak is often listed, which is the time just before Fajr, a period when it's recommended to stop eating and drinking if you are fasting. Syuruk indicates sunrise, and while it’s not a prayer time itself, it’s useful for knowing when the Fajr prayer time has ended. The jadwal sholat is a tool to help you manage your day around your prayers, so understanding how to read it properly is super helpful.

Moreover, it’s good to note that the jadwal sholat might include a small buffer time. This accounts for minor variations in calculations and ensures that you are praying within the prescribed window. If you are using a mobile app, you can often customize these settings to match your preference or the guidelines of your local mosque.

Another cool tip is to use travel time wisely. If you’re commuting or traveling, you can perform jamak (combining prayers) if necessary. This is a concession in Islam for those who have valid reasons, such as travel or illness. Check with your local imam or Islamic scholar for guidelines on how to perform jamak. It’s a flexible solution for those on the move.
